About

Discover and track your favorite anime, manga, music, and games. Organize your progress with customizable lists, set release reminders, and connect with a community of fans. Explore a vast library and never miss a new episode or release.

Anime and manga discovery
Progress tracking (watchlist)
Customizable lists (in-progress, completed, etc.)
Release countdowns and reminders
Community timeline and global feed
Discussion forums

FAQ

What does Kurozora do?

Kurozora is an app designed for fans of Japanese media. It allows you to discover new and classic anime, manga, music, and games. You can also track your progress, organize your media library, and connect with other fans.

How can I track my anime and manga progress?

The app provides personalized watchlist and tracking features. You can categorize your watched anime, read manga, and played games into six lists: In-Progress, Planning, Completed, On-Hold, Dropped, and Ignored. You can also reorder these lists and see upcoming releases.

Is Kurozora free to use?

The app is free to download and use, offering a vast library and discovery features. It also includes in-app purchases, suggesting optional enhancements or content available for purchase.

Can I interact with other fans on Kurozora?

Yes, Kurozora fosters a community aspect. You can share your thoughts and excitement with other fans on your own timeline and a global feed. The app also facilitates deeper discussions about your favorite topics.

What kind of Japanese media can I track?

Kurozora covers a broad spectrum of Japanese media. This includes anime series and movies, manga volumes, music albums and artists, and video games across various platforms.
